This poster was part of an exhibit in Échirolles, France, celebrating the Polish design tradition, specifically circus posters. The subject was completely foreign to me as an Arab designer. The inspiration came from the bold circus "cyrk" typography of the circus posters, as well as Polish designers who designed their own posters of foreign films, adapting them to their own language and vernacular. The cyrk lettering was made by paper, with all the letters connected, in homage to the connectivity of Arabic.
